The Avengers: Endgame Trailer May Have Teased Iron Man’s MCU Exit

Until Marvel Studios gives us more Avengers: Endgame material to chew over, the fans will be analyzing the film’s first trailer for all it's worth, and as the literal frame-by-frame scrutiny of the teaser continues, the internet has offered some pretty imaginative theories.

Just take this new suggestion from Reddit from user iAMA_Leb_AMA, who acknowledges that their new find “Might be a coincidence..might be something a ton sadder.” The post consists of a screenshot of the ship that Tony Stark is seen drifting in as he slowly runs out of oxygen. Alongside this image are a few googled illustrations of swallows, which show a similar shape to the vessel that Iron Man’s flying in.

The post also includes some text explaining the symbolic significance of these birds as indicators that a journey is nearing its end. From here, the suggestion is made that Stark’s own MCU journey might be coming to a close, be it through death or a quiet retirement.

While it’s not impossible that Anthony and Joe Russo had such a metaphor in mind, this theory still seems like a real stretch. After all, out of the thousands of species of bird in existence, the swallow is hardly the only family to bear some resemblance to the outline of Stark’s inherently bird-like ship.

All the same, it’s understandable that fans would be looking so closely for clues of Stark’s impending departure from the series, given how popular a prediction this has been. As the character who helped kick off this whole franchise with 2008’s Iron Man, you could argue that there’d be no better way to mark the end of an era than giving Robert Downey Jr.’s character a heartfelt sendoff, though the theories of Captain America’s departure remain similarly prominent. In any case, we’ll likely find out who’ll still be around for Marvel’s Phase 4 when Avengers: Endgame hits theaters on April 26th, 2019.
